Pricing Analysis

Nutshell's $13-79/month per-seat tiering with explicit contact limits (1K, 10K, 50K, unlimited) competes directly in Zoho CRM's zone but with clearer feature boundaries. This transparency gives Nutshell procurement advantage vs. competitors with opaque feature documentation; buyers can precisely match tier to prospect volume without spreadsheet guesswork.

The jump from Starter ($13, 1K contacts) to Professional ($39, 10K contacts) to Enterprise ($79, unlimited) mirrors Agile CRM's forced tier progression strategy. Teams at 10K+ contacts hit upgrade pressure immediately, creating multiplicative cost for growing databases-a 10-person team with 50K prospects needs Enterprise tier ($79/person/month = $790/month minimum).

Nutshell's emphasis on sales-specific features (activity tracking, deal visualization, reporting) positions it as HubSpot Sales Hub-lite, not general CRM. This narrows addressable market but creates high switching costs among activity-obsessed sales managers trained on Nutshell's daily action discipline workflows.

Pricing Plans (5)

Per user, per month

$13/mo
  • βœ“Unlimited contacts & storage
  • βœ“Email & calendar sync
  • βœ“AI Chatbot
  • βœ“Form builder & landing pages
  • βœ“AI Agent Marketplace

Per user, per month

$25/mo
  • βœ“Activity reports
  • βœ“Sales quotas
  • βœ“Lead assignment rules
  • βœ“Custom stage goals
  • βœ“Hot leads

Per user, per month

Popular
$42/mo
  • βœ“5 custom pipelines
  • βœ“Advanced reporting
  • βœ“Sales automation
  • βœ“AI lead recaps & next steps
  • βœ“Meeting scheduler

Per user, per month

$59/mo
  • βœ“10 custom pipelines
  • βœ“Advanced meeting scheduler
  • βœ“Audit log & changelog
  • βœ“Send email templates from Gmail & Outlook
  • βœ“Additional teams & territories

Per user, per month

$79/mo
  • βœ“Unlimited pipelines
  • βœ“Unlimited custom fields
  • βœ“Enterprise SSO
  • βœ“SQL data access
  • βœ“Phone support
